On 11/21/2024 (89 FR 92091), Commerce published in the Federal Register its amended final results of administrative review of the antidumping duty order on certain welded carbon steel standard pipes and tubes from India for the period 05/01/2018 through 04/30/2019. See message 4331430, dated 11/26/2024. 2. Title 19 U.S.C. 1520(a)(4) authorizes refunds prior to liquidation whenever an importer of record declares or it is ascertained that excess duties, fees, charges, or exactions have been deposited or paid. In accordance with 19 U.S.C. 1520(a)(4), CBP is authorized to grant a refund, if requested by the importer, of cash deposits for entries of certain welded carbon steel standard pipes and tubes from India from the entities listed in paragraph 4 below which were entered, or withdrawn from warehouse, for consumption during the period 03/19/2021 (date of final results in the Federal Register) through 11/16/2024 (day before the applicable date of the amended final results in the Federal Register). 3. The refund amount will be calculated by determining the difference between the amount of cash deposits paid as a result of the application of the final results rate and the amount due as a result of the application of the amended final results rate. 4. Listed below is the deposit rate that was assigned to certain firms in the final results. See message 1081402, dated 03/22/2021. In addition, listed below is the amended deposit rate assigned in the amended final results (see message number 4331430, dated 11/26/2024): Producer and/or Exporter: Garg Tube Export LLP and Garg Tube Limited Case number: A-533-502-114 Final results rate: 13.90% Amended final results rate: 4.25% 5. Do not liquidate entries of certain welded carbon steel standard pipes and tubes from India produced and/or exported by the entities listed in paragraph 4 above until specific liquidation instructions are issued. 6. The assessment of antidumping duties by CBP on shipments or entries of this merchandise is subject to the provisions of section 778 of the Tariff Act of 1930, as amended. Section 778 requires that CBP pay interest on overpayments or assess interest on underpayments of the required amounts deposited as estimated antidumping duties. The interest provisions are not applicable to cash posted as estimated antidumping duties before the date of publication of the antidumping duty order. Interest shall be calculated from the date payment of estimated antidumping duties is required through the date of liquidation. The rate at which such interest is payable is the rate in effect under section 6621 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1954 for such period. 7.
